Job Title: Commercial Manager (Healthcare Industry)
Location: Gbagada
Employment Type: Full-Time
Department: Sales & Business Development
Salary: 300,000 - 400,000
Reports To: Managing Director

Job Summary:
We are seeking a dynamic, results-driven Commercial Manager to lead and manage our commercial operations within the healthcare sector. The ideal candidate will have a proven track record in sales, client relationship management, and strategic business development. You will be responsible for driving revenue growth, managing key accounts, delivering impactful presentations, and working cross-functionally to support business expansion.

Key Responsibilities:
Sales & Business Development:
• Develop and execute commercial strategies aligned with company objectives.
• Identify new business opportunities and drive sales growth across healthcare segments (e.g., hospitals, clinics, diagnostics, pharma, medical devices, etc.).
• Prepare and present commercial proposals, tenders, and pricing models.
• Achieve sales targets, revenue goals, and market share growth.

Client Relationship Management:
• Build and maintain strong, long-term relationships with key clients, stakeholders, and partners.
• Serve as the main point of contact for high-value clients, ensuring satisfaction and retention.
• Resolve client issues with a proactive and service-oriented approach.

Presentations & Communication:
• Deliver high-quality presentations and product/service demonstrations to stakeholders, clients, and internal teams.
• Represent the company at conferences, trade shows, and industry events.

Commercial Strategy & Reporting:
• Analyze market trends, competitor activity, and customer feedback to refine commercial strategies.
• Prepare sales forecasts, budget plans, and performance reports for senior leadership.

Qualifications:
• Bachelor’s degree in Business, Healthcare Management or a related field.
• 3+ years of experience in a commercial/sales role within the healthcare or medical industry.
• Proven experience in B2B, B2C sales, contract negotiation, and client account management.
• Strong presentation, communication, and interpersonal skills.
• Excellent analytical and strategic thinking abilities.
• Familiarity with CRM systems and sales performance tools.

Preferred Skills:
• Understanding of healthcare processes and healthcare ecosystem.
• Experience working with hospitals, payers, or healthcare providers.
• Knowledge of relevant regulatory and compliance frameworks (e.g., HIPAA, local health authority regulations).
